Khao Chae
Khao Chae is a traditional Thai dish of rice soaked in jasmine-scented water, typically served with an array of flavorful side dishes. It's a refreshing and aromatic meal, perfect for warmer weather. The side dishes offer a delightful contrast of sweet, salty, and savory flavors.

Mise en place
Ingredients
Converted for display; the recipe amounts stay equivalent.
rice
- 2 cupjasmine rice
- 4 cupwater
scented water
- 10 pcsjasmine flowers
- 2 cupice
luk kapi
- 200 gbeef, minced
- 1 tbspshrimp paste
- 2 pcsshallot, finely chopped
- 2 clovegarlic, minced
- 2 tbsppalm sugar
- 0.5 cupvegetable oil
egg net
- 2 pcsegg
garnish
- 1 pcscucumber, julienned
- 1 pcsgreen mango, julienned
- 2 pcsspring onion, sliced
- 1 pcsred chili, thinly sliced
- 0.25 cupcilantro, chopped

The method
Step by step
- 1
Rinse the jasmine rice thoroughly under cold water until the water runs clear. Soak the rice in fresh water for at least 30 minutes.
About 30 min
Cook’s note: Rinsing removes excess starch, resulting in fluffier rice.
- 2
Drain the soaked rice and steam it for 20-25 minutes until fully cooked and fluffy. Set aside to cool completely.
About 25 min
Cook’s note: Ensure the rice is spread out to cool quickly and prevent clumping.
- 3
To prepare the scented water, place the jasmine flowers in a clean bowl with water. Let it infuse for at least 2 hours, or overnight in the refrigerator.
About 2 hr
Cook’s note: For a stronger aroma, you can gently bruise the jasmine petals before adding them to the water.
- 4
For the luk kapi (shrimp paste balls), heat a small amount of vegetable oil in a pan over medium heat. Sauté shallot and garlic until fragrant.
About 5 min
- 5
Add minced beef and cook until browned. Stir in the shrimp paste and palm sugar, cooking until the sugar dissolves and the mixture is well combined and fragrant.
About 8 min
Cook’s note: Break up any lumps of beef as it cooks.
- 6
Remove the mixture from heat and let it cool. Once cool enough to handle, form small, bite-sized balls.
About 10 min
Cook’s note: If the mixture is too sticky, slightly dampen your hands.
- 7
Prepare the egg net by whisking the eggs. Heat a non-stick pan over medium-low heat and lightly oil it.
About 2 min
- 8
Drizzle the egg mixture into the pan in a thin, lacy pattern to create an egg net. Cook until set, then gently remove and let cool. Slice into thin strips.
About 5 min
Cook’s note: A squeeze bottle or a fork can help create a fine net pattern.
- 9
To serve, place a portion of cooled steamed rice in a bowl. Add ice to the jasmine-scented water and pour it over the rice until it's just covered.
About 2 min
Cook’s note: The water should be cold to provide a refreshing contrast.
- 10
Arrange the luk kapi balls, egg net strips, julienned cucumber, green mango, sliced spring onion, red chili, and cilantro around the rice.
About 5 min
Cook’s note: Serve immediately for the best experience.

Keep it good
Store leftover side dishes and rice separ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ator.
This dish is traditionally eaten cold; reheating is not recommended.
